What Actually Happened

Two customer cancellations in quick succession — first Marvell, then Celestial AI — stripped POET of its near-term revenue pipeline. A shareholder lawsuit followed, alleging the company misled investors. The stock's reaction ran counter to the news: a roughly 50% weekly surge. That kind of move on bad news has one name, and it is not a thesis upgrade. Heavy short interest met forced covering. Price disconnected from business value. The rally runs until the covering stops. The squeeze is the story, not the company.

The Catch

At $10.9368 with $1mn in TTM revenue and a forward P/E that is literally infinite, POET trades on promise, not results — and two named customers just cancelled contracts. Short squeezes are self-terminating mechanical events. When the covering exhausts itself, the stock reverts to what the fundamentals support. A company generating $1mn annually with no earnings path provides very little support. The shareholder lawsuit adds a second countdown clock that retail momentum cannot override.
